Question How to install xmessage


I have installed wine in my solaris system (sxde 9/07) by using this instruction., the 'mature' type for sol 10. Now when I am trying to launch it , it's giving me :

Quote:
Warning:
The Wine launcher is unable to find the xmessage program,
which it needs to properly notify you of Wine execution status
or problems.

This launcher script relies heavily on finding this tool,
and without it, it will behave very poorly.

We strongly recommend that you use your distribution's
software methods to locate xmessage, or alternatively
use your favourite internet search engine to find out
how you are supposed to install xmessage on your system.
Now , I have searched for xmessage in the websites :

1)http://ftp.sunfreeware.com/ftp/pub/freeware/i386/10/

2)http://www.blastwave.org/packages.php

But , I found no result.

Please help me to solve the problem.

Thank you.
